The demand for energy conservation in large-scale facilities is increasing year by year, and there is a growing momentum for air-conditioning equipment operation managers to respond to this demand. Due to the fear of complaints and the resulting busyness of dealing with them, it becomes difficult for operation managers to make drastic operational changes, to try and implement measures such as relaxing temperature settings or stopping AHU fans. In this study, the purpose of this study is to use the physical quantities related to AHU in central air conditioning equipment to clarify the physical quantities when complaints about the thermal environment arise, and to determine whether the operation manager should relax the set temperature or stop the operation of the AHU fan. Consider the ''discomfort index'' that can be used as a guideline.
